    I glue the resistors black side down then if you put too much paint on you can scrape it off. If you scrape the black (resistor) side it usually damages the resistor coating. I found plastic axles tend to fail after a while, probably from slight flexing, so I swap them around between cars so only metal axles have resistors. I use smaller resistors (402), more fiddly but almost invisible once painted.

    Fascinating vid. Couple questions: how much more resistance do you think that conductive paint adds to each installation; have you calculated how many of these you can do before the current draw becomes a problem? After all, each install is a parallel circuit so each one reduces effective resistance and increases current draw.

    • @mikerubynfs
      @mikerubynfs Рік тому +2

      Compared to the value of the resistor very little. Each resistor takes about 1.5mA, so 1000 would take 1.5 amps. I had about 200 cars on the layout, two resistors per car so 0.6 A spread between two 5A boosters, not a problem.
